وب سایت تخصصی شرکت فرین
دسته بندی دوره ها

[NEW: 2023] – Spring Boot 3 Tutorial For Beginners

سرفصل های دوره

Master the most required framework in the market with get started with Git and GitHub


1. Introduction
  • 1. Introduction

  • 2. Introduction to spring boot
  • 1. What is Spring & Spring boot
  • 2. Why you should learn Spring

  • 3. Spring architecutre
  • 1. Data Access Module
  • 2. Web Module
  • 3. AOP - Aspect - Instrumentation - Messaging
  • 4. Test Module

  • 4. Git & GitHub
  • 1. What is Git
  • 2. Why you should have a GitHub account

  • 5. Project Overview
  • 1. Project overview

  • 6. Bootstrap the application
  • 1. Create a new Spring boot project (Spring Initializer)
  • 2. Understand project structure
  • 3. Start the Server
  • 4. Add an index.html file and display Hello World
  • 5. Create a new GitHub repository
  • 6. Git Commit - Push (Command line)

  • 7. Building a sample REST API
  • 1. What is a REST API
  • 2. Create Student Controller
  • 3. Test with the browser
  • 4. Git Commit - Push (Using Intellij)

  • 8. Service Layer
  • 1. Create the Student class
  • 2. Expose Students list and tes the changes
  • 3. Create Student Service
  • 4. Create findAllStudents in the Service
  • 5. Display the students list
  • 6. Dependency Injection
  • 7. Git Commit - Push

  • 9. Data Access Object (DAO) Layer
  • 1. Create student service interface and refactor the code
  • 2. Extend the Student Repository
  • 3. Implement the InMemoryStudentDao
  • 4. Use the DAO in the Service
  • 5. Add the new Endpoints to the controller
  • 6. Test the API
  • 7. How Spring dispatches the requests
  • 8. Git Commit - Push

  • 10. Connect and Interact with a DataBase
  • 1. Add Spring Data JPA dependency
  • 2. Add the database properties and test the connection
  • 3. Transform the Student class to an Entity
  • 4. Explaining the JPA repository
  • 5. Implement the DBStudentService
  • 6. Understanding the Dependency Injection (DI) and switch to the implementation
  • 7. Test the new API

  • 11. What Comes next
  • 1. Outro
  • 45,900 تومان
    بیش از یک محصول به صورت دانلودی میخواهید؟ محصول را به سبد خرید اضافه کنید.
    خرید دانلودی فوری

    در این روش نیاز به افزودن محصول به سبد خرید و تکمیل اطلاعات نیست و شما پس از وارد کردن ایمیل خود و طی کردن مراحل پرداخت لینک های دریافت محصولات را در ایمیل خود دریافت خواهید کرد.

    ایمیل شما:
    تولید کننده:
    مدرس:
    شناسه: 11624
    حجم: 956 مگابایت
    مدت زمان: 151 دقیقه
    تاریخ انتشار: 20 اردیبهشت 1402
    طراحی سایت و خدمات سئو

    45,900 تومان
    افزودن به سبد خرید